French Door Fridge With Ice Dispenser
The interior storage of most 36-inch standard-depth French-door refrigerators is similar: two side-byside plastic drawers for crispers, and adjustable glass shelves. Some come with large, convenient door pockets as well as higher-end ice makers.
Special features can raise the price, such as an in-door water dispenser, or smart platforms. Take into consideration whether you'd need these features when shopping around.
Stores
The freezer section is at the bottom of a French-door refrigerator. The refrigerator is on the top. This design makes it easy to access all the items you need, while also maximizing storage space. The majority of models also come with many different customizable storage options like door bins and shelves that are adjustable for more flexible organization. The storage capacity of French door refrigerators differs depending on the size, but it is generally more than a side-by-side model.
Most French Door Fridge ice dispenser-door fridges come with a separate temperature-controlled drawer between the fridge and freezer. This compartment is perfect for items that are in high demand, such as kids' snacks and drinks or food items which are best kept at an elevated temperature than the rest (like wine).
Some models feature a second, deeper drawer that switches from freezer to refrigerator at the push of an button. This extra space is ideal for storing bulky foods such as party platters, or large french style fridge freezer bags of frozen veggies. Many models also include a filtered water dispenser, which is ideal for quickly getting cold, fresh-tasting drinking water.
Some models also have intelligent features that help keep your food and drinks fresher longer. Bosch refrigerators, for example include VitaFresh technology that regulates both the humidity and temperature levels according to the settings you select. This makes food stay fresh and crisp for up to 3 times longer than in a refrigerator without this feature.
Other convenient refrigerator features are a hands-free autofill water dispenser and advanced refrigerators with ice makers. The first allows you to automatically fill up containers by pressing a button. The second makes 2.9lbs of cubed ice that is clear every day.
LG French-door refrigerators, like the LRFLC2706S shown here, offer the best french door fridge with ice maker combination of capacity and design for this price. In addition to its 26.5 cubic feet of refrigerator and freezer space, this model also has a sensor-activated water dispenser that is easy to operate using your fingers, and an Ice maker that can create up to 2 1/2 pounds of the stuff per day.
Energy Efficiency
Many French door fridges are Energy Star rated, which will help you save money as well as reduce your carbon footprint. Efficiency in energy is measured using a unit called kilowatt-hours per year. You can make use of an online tool like EnergyGuide to compare models to determine which one might best fit your budget.
Many features of french door fridge with drawer door refrigerators to make them more energy efficient with a large interior that accommodates large pizza boxes and platters and also the ability to organize things like adjustable shelving and gallon-sized door bins. If you want to save money on your utility bills or choose an ENERGY STAR refrigerator, it is important to take into consideration the size of your family and how much space you will need when selecting a French-door refrigerator.
Certain French door refrigerators come with filtered water as well as cubed or crushed ice, and other options to meet your hydration requirements and entertainment requirements. Temperature control settings can be adjusted to optimize food preservation and minimize waste.
In general, a French door refrigerator is typically more expensive than other kinds of refrigerators, however they're expected to last for 10 to 20 years if you take care of maintenance. Before you purchase a high-end French door refrigerator, you should examine the local codes and regulations pertaining to installation. You'll need to determine whether there are restrictions on where you can place the refrigerator and if your home is obstructed by doors, like narrow doorways or stairs.
Some refrigerators are equipped with smart technology integration. This lets you monitor French door fridge ice dispenser and control the refrigerator from anywhere that has an internet connection. This is a great option for busy families as you can easily search for recipes or create an order list. The refrigerator can alert you when the door has been opened or if the filters require replacement. Depending on your preference, you can choose from a variety of smart refrigerators, french door Fridge ice dispenser ranging from basic to high-tech. Smart refrigerators are a great investment in any kitchen. They offer convenience and peace-of-mind over the long term.

Ice Dispenser
The ice maker itself is a fairly simple device. The motor turns on and rotates a gear, which then turns on a shaft with ejector teeth which scoop ice cubes of the mold and into the storage bin. Once the ice is made, the shut-off arm rises and stops the cycle. Then the ice sits in the freezer until you are ready to use it.
Certain refrigerator brands put the ice-making device in the freezer instead of within the door. This is common in side-by-side models however not all refrigerators equipped with ice makers make this design choice. They typically are smaller than French door refrigerators that have an internal ice maker.
You can also purchase a refrigerator that houses the ice-making and dispensing parts together in a single door. This is usually less expensive than buying the components separately.
